Where is This Key Valve Situated?


The primary water line supply can vary, so you may need to find time to determine where it is. However, when your home is getting soaked as a result of a burst pipeline, you do not have the luxury of time throughout an emergency. Therefore, you need to prepare for this plumbing dilemma by discovering where the shutoff is located.
This shutoff valve could resemble a round valve (with a lever-type handle) or an entrance shutoff (with a circle spigot). Placement relies on the age of your residence and the environment in your location. Examine the complying with typical areas:
  • Inside of House: In cooler environments, the city supply pipes face your house. Inspect typical utility locations like your basement, laundry room, or garage. A most likely location is near the water heater. In the cellar, this shutoff will be at your eye level. On the various other primary floorings, you may need to bend down to discover it.

  • Outdoors on the Outside Wall: The primary shutoff is outside the home in exotic climates where they do not experience winter months. It is frequently attached to an exterior wall. Look for it near an outdoor faucet.

  • Outdoors by the Street: If you can not discover the valve anywhere else, it is time to check your street. It could be outdoors next to your water meter. Maybe listed below the accessibility panel near the ground on your street. You may require a meter secret that's sold in hardware shops to take off the panel cover. You can discover 2 valves, one for city usage as well as one for your residence. Make certain you shut off the ideal one. And also you will certainly recognize that you did when none of the taps in your house release freshwater.

    What to Do When a Pipe Bursts in Your Home


    A burst pipe is one of a homeowner's worst nightmares. Not knowing the signs and being unprepared for this plumbing issue can result in more water damage and clean up. Here are the warning signs of a pipe about to burst and the steps you can take if it happens.


    Warning Signs for Burst Pipes


  • Rusty, discolored water with a bad smell


  • Puddles under your sinks


  • Abrupt changes in water pressure


  • A spike in your water bill


  • Clanging noises coming from pipes behind the walls


  • What to Do When a Pipe Bursts


    Turn off your water. The sooner you do this, the better. Shutting off your main valve will help minimize the damage to your home.



    Drain the faucets. After the water has been turned off, drain the remaining water by opening your faucets. Doing so will help prevent areas from freezing and also relieve pressure within your pipe system to avoid more bursts.



    Locate the burst pipe. Look for bulging ceilings, warping and other signs of where the water damage has occurred. Once you locate the pipe, you will be able to determine if it is a small crack that can be patched or a major repair that needs to be dealt with right away.

    Document the damage. If you have extensive pipe damage, be sure to take photos of the affected areas so you can document a claim with your insurance. Take close-up photos of the damage and use a measuring tape to show how high the water is. You should also take photos from different angles for a wider picture of the affected areas.



    Start cleaning. After you have documented the damage, start cleaning up the water as soon as possible. The longer the water sits, the higher the chance that mold will develop.
